Gallbladder 41 (GB 41)
Pinyin Name & English Translation
Zulingqi, Foot Overlooking Tears
Location
In the depression distal to the junction of the fourth and fifth metatarsal bones, on the lateral side of the tendon of muscle extensor digiti minimi of the foot.
Indications
Headache, vertigo, pain of the outer canthus, scrofula, pain in hypochondriac region, distending pain of the breast, ireegular menstruation, pain and swelling of the dorsum of the foot and toe.
Traditional Action
Resolves damp-heat, promotes the smooth flow of Liver Qi, regulates the Girdle vessel (Dai Mai Vessel).
